Transaction 81125577db050a007a23a463d1eedb59b1705cfceb81b3a9e5b1a07ad0984d30
1 Input
1 Output
-
81125577db050a007a23a463d1eedb59b1705cfceb81b3a9e5b1a07ad0984d30:0
- value
- 109426
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e2005c83bc9f30fd2bb04588da9cabe81f0dac1d OP_EQUAL
- address
- 3NJ151MVctzKZXxUCUr9MvFjbZ5vTJYNXc